2. Properly Store Your Inventory
As a candy business, you will have inventory that requires proper inventory management. With the right inventory management techniques in place, you will be able to keep track of your items and ensure that they鈥檙e stored properly.
When it comes to candy, the inventory management process will vary depending on the type of candy. However, it鈥檚 important to keep storage facilities, such as warehousing spaces, at about 65 degrees Fahrenheit to ensure the best possible quality of your candy.听
This is true for all additional storage areas and display cases, especially if you have a brick and mortar store. You should not store heat-sensitive items in places that have direct sun exposure as it can cause damage and melting.听
3. Pay Attention to the Packaging Process
Packaging candy and getting it ready for shipment may seem like an easy task. However, there鈥檚 more thought that goes into it than you might think.听
Chances are you鈥檒l wonder, 鈥how much does it cost to ship a package?鈥 While this is an important question, it鈥檚 not the only one you should consider. It鈥檚 also important to pay attention to the actual packaging process to ensure that your candy stays safe.听
Using candy boxes, candy pads, inserts, and similar sustainable eCommerce packaging will work wonders at helping protect your candy. It鈥檚 best to choose candy boxes and similar accessories that comply with food safety system requirements and help you stay organized. Be sure to also look into how to measure a box for shipping.
Candy items鈥搒uch as chocolate鈥揳re delicate, which is why you should always prioritize safety. To do this, choose a sturdy shipping box large enough to support your items, use cushioning, and include a cooling pack.
During the candy shipping process, it鈥檚 important that your box is sturdy enough to support your items on all sides. This is because many boxes get jostled around during transit, and they need to be able to survive without a hitch.听
Temperature control is essential when you ship perishable candy items, such as chocolate. To ensure that these items stay intact, you have to regulate the temperature inside your candy package. Using dry ice or gel ice packs usually does the trick.听

The Cheapest Way to Ship Candy
In the United States, the cheapest way to ship candy is through the United States Postal Service (USPS). They offer a First Class Package Service that is an affordable shipping option and applies to packages that weigh 16 ounces or less. Average shipping prices for such packages range between $3 and $5 per package.
Keep in mind that USPS doesn鈥檛 allow people to utilize their free packaging offers when shipping First Class packages. This means you will have to supply your own boxes and packaging items.

Will Chocolate Melt In the Mail?
It is possible for chocolate to melt in the mail; however, if the proper precautions have been taken, chocolate will arrive safely when shipped by mail. Different chocolate types have different melting points and in some cases, it can be as low as 70掳F.听
When shipping chocolate items, it鈥檚 important to include cooling packaging materials such as ice packs. This will allow you to regulate the temperature within the package and avoid common shipping problems such as chocolate melting.听

Does FedEx Ship Perishable Items?
Yes, FedEx will ship perishable items; however, it鈥檚 important for you to declare that the items are perishable and use the proper packaging. To ensure safe and quality deliveries, perishable items should be shipped using overnight or 1-day shipping options.
